摘 要:以贵州省遵义县某高粱生产基地单元为依托,根据所选单元为“坝区”的特点和红茅糯2号高粱培植技术路线以及作业机械的性能,分析了高粱从播种到收割各阶段所用机械的优化配置和组装成套方法,得到了高粱生产全过程机械化的最佳机具配置方案。研究结果表明:高粱生产机具的选型应综合考虑配套机械的数量、作业方式、工作效率、生产质量、作业时限和成本等;并应结合高粱栽培技术要求因地制宜地配套动力机械及田间作业机械;同时还应根据所选机型对其进行田间试验,确保所选机型合理适用。研究结果可为贵州省高粱全程机械化生产的机具配置提供参考。Based on the sorghum production unit in Zunyi county,Guizhou Province,the optimal allocation and assembly methods of machinery used in different stages from sowing to harvesting of sorghum were analyzed.According to the characteristics of the selected unit as"dam area",and the technical route of Hongmao Nuo No.2 sorghum cultivation and optimal allocation scheme was obtained.The result show that the quantity,operation mode,work efficiency,production quality,operation time limit and cost of supporting machinery should be take into account when the machinery is selected,and power machinery,field operation machinery should be equipped in combination with the requirements of sorghum cultivation technology and suit to local conditions.Finally,the field test should also be carried out according to the selected model to ensure that the selected is reasonable and applicable.The results of this study can provide a reference for the whole course mechanization of sorghum production in Guizhou Province of China.
